History

Established in 1911.

A tradition of excellence for over 100 years, Gaido’s Restaurant was started back in 1911 when S. J. Gaido first opened his doors to the public. Visitors often arrived to the restaurant by horse and buggy, boat or on the old interurban line. The Gaido’s family commitment was to make the trip worthwhile with the best in service and the freshest seafood available.

Today, the trip to Galveston is much easier but the service and cuisine of Gaido’s Restaurant remains the same. All of the seafood is meticulously inspected and prepared by hand.

Gaido’s still peels shrimp, shuck oysters and filets fish the old fashioned way. Gaido’s has continued this tradition for ninety-​plus years and that’s not about to change. All of the sauces, salad dressings and desserts are homemade from Gaido’s family recipes, using only finest of fresh ingredients.
